Due to the high hardness and brittleness of special ceramic materials, they are difficult to machine, especially for deep holes and grooves with a diameter of less than 1mm. Currently, laser processing is widely used. The principle of laser processing is to utilize the high brightness and high directionality of lasers to concentrate light energy within a certain range of space, thereby obtaining a relatively high optical power density and generating high temperatures ranging from thousands to tens of thousands of degrees. At this high temperature, ceramic materials can quickly melt or even vaporize.

The working principle of laser processing determines many drawbacks of laser processing:

1. The workpiece processed by laser has defects such as molten solidification layer and cracks.

2. Due to the focusing process of the laser, the holes processed by the laser will appear conical or barrel shaped.

3. The depth to diameter ratio of laser drilling should not exceed 10, and the thickness should not exceed 2mm, making it impossible to work on some thicker products.
